An overflowing gutter can quickly turn a routine rainstorm into a problem for your home. Instead of carrying water safely away from the roof and foundation, an overwhelmed system may spill water over its edges, soak exterior walls, damage landscaping, and allow moisture to collect around the foundation. Experienced gutter companies can evaluate the entire system and determine what is preventing water from moving where it should.
Overflow does not always mean that the gutter itself has completely failed. Debris, poor positioning, inadequate capacity, damaged components, and drainage problems can all contribute to water spilling over the edge. Understanding the possible causes can help homeowners recognize when professional attention is needed and prevent a relatively small drainage concern from contributing to more extensive property damage.
According to This Old House, gutters are available in widths ranging from five to eight inches. The appropriate size depends on factors such as roof area, rainfall volume, and the amount of water the system must manage. Managing Clogged Gutters
Recognizing Debris Accumulation
Leaves, twigs, pine needles, seed pods, and other outdoor debris can collect inside gutters throughout the year. As this material builds up, it reduces the amount of space available for rainwater. During heavier storms, water may have nowhere to go and begin spilling over the sides.
Identifying Hidden Blockages
Not every obstruction is easy to see from ground level. Debris may become packed around outlets or settle in sections where the gutter has limited flow. These hidden blockages can cause water to back up even when other portions of the system appear clear.
Addressing Downspout Restrictions
A gutter may be relatively clear while its downspout remains blocked. When water cannot enter or move through the downspout efficiently, it backs up into the gutter channel. Correcting Improper Gutter Pitch
Recognizing Poor Drainage Angles
Gutters require an appropriate slope so gravity can direct water toward the downspouts. If a section is too level or slopes in the wrong direction, water may collect rather than drain. Standing water can eventually overflow during additional rainfall and place unnecessary weight on the system.
Identifying Low Sections
Over time, sections of a gutter system can sag or shift. These low points create areas where water pools, particularly after sustained rainfall. The added weight of standing water can worsen the problem and place greater stress on hangers and connections.

Repairing Damaged Gutter Components
Identifying Loose Connections
Fasteners and connections may loosen as gutters experience weather exposure, temperature changes, and the weight of water and debris. When sections begin pulling away from the fascia, their position can change enough to interfere with proper drainage and contribute to overflow.
Recognizing Warped Sections
Physical damage can alter the shape of a gutter channel. Bent or warped sections may prevent water from flowing evenly toward an outlet. Instead, water can collect around the damaged area and spill over during periods of steady rain.

Resolving Roof Runoff Problems
Observing Water Flow Patterns
Sometimes overflow occurs because rainwater moves from the roof in a concentrated stream. Roof valleys and complex rooflines can direct significant volumes toward one small gutter section. If water reaches the channel faster than it can be carried away, it may overshoot or spill over the edge.
